← 返回列表
一种面向去中心化存储的数据审计方法
摘要文本
本发明提供一种面向去中心化存储的数据审计方法,属于完整性审计技术领域。包括:将待审计的原始文件分割获得的文件块及文件块签名上传至P2P节点,并将标识信息发送至以太坊智能合约;P2P节点获取以太坊的区块信息并生成第一随机数,将第一随机数与预设阈值比对确认是否入围;入围节点将公钥添加至第一随机数中生成第二随机数,根据第二随机数及文件索引值映射关系选择文件块,获得挑战集合;入围节点基于入围数据块及对应签名,通过待证明问题的证明密钥生成零知识证明;入围节点将挑战集合、零知识证明和随机数集合发送至智能合约进行待证明问题的验证,完成审计。本发明保证了审计的公平性和安全性,提升了审计的效率。。更多数据:www.macrodatas.cn
申请人信息
- 申请人:南开大学
- 申请人地址:300071 天津市南开区卫津路94号
- 发明人: 南开大学
专利详细信息
| 项目 | 内容 |
|---|---|
| 专利名称 | 一种面向去中心化存储的数据审计方法 |
| 专利类型 | 发明申请 |
| 申请号 | CN202410246018.3 |
| 申请日 | 2024/3/5 |
| 公告号 | CN117834303A |
| 公开日 | 2024/4/5 |
| IPC主分类号 | H04L9/40 |
| 权利人 | 南开大学 |
| 发明人 | 王刚; 孙永霞; 阎萌; 刘晓光; 孙辉; 王文蕊 |
| 地址 | 天津市津南区海河教育园区同砚路38号 |
专利主权项内容
1.一种面向去中心化存储的数据审计方法,其特征在于,包括:S1:将待审计的原始文件分割获得的文件块及文件块签名上传至P2P节点,并将所述文件块对应的标识信息发送至以太坊中的智能合约;S2:所述P2P节点获取以太坊的区块信息,并根据所述区块信息生成第一随机数,将所述第一随机数与智能合约预设阈值进行比对以确认入围节点;S3:P2P节点中被选中的入围节点将公钥添加至所述第一随机数中,生成第二随机数,根据所述第二随机数及所述原始文件中的索引值映射关系选择文件块,获得挑战集合;S4:所述入围节点基于所述挑战集合包括的被选中的入围数据块及所述入围数据块的签名,通过待证明问题的证明密钥生成零知识证明;S5:所述入围节点将所述挑战集合、所述零知识证明和包括第一随机数及第二随机数的随机数集合发送至智能合约,智能合约执行待证明问题的验证算法,获得验证结果。